Generation Y, Gen Y, Net
Generation, Millennials, Echo Boomers, iGeneration, Second
Baby Boom, Google Generation, Myspace Generation, MyPod
Generation, Generation Next, Nintendo Generation, and the
Cynical Generation...
Can't
decide which is the best term? Why not learn from
Generation Y expert Peter Sheahan why this upwardly
mobile generation - born between 1978 and 1994 - are currently
the most influential consumer and employee group in the
world. Gain a deep understanding from Peter of the mindsets
that drive their behaviour so you can better attract, manage and
engage this generation, both as customers and as staff. Peter
will enlighten you in an entertaining session which
will:
- Provide
an insightful introduction to the generation differences in the
workplace
- Help
managers and leaders identify the biases and blind spots they may
have about Generation y
Explore
how the mindset of Generation Y is trending upwards and how it will
redefine how you treat your staff and customers.
Peter Sheahan
is a best-selling author, successful business consultant and
internationally acclaimed speaker with a reputation for
transforming organizations by turning traditional paradigms on
their head. Appreciated globally for his cutting-edge insight into
workforce trends and generational change, Peter was among the first
to uncover the Generation Y revolution in the workplace in his
groundbreaking book Generation Y: Thriving (and Surviving) with
Generation Y at Work.
